Dame is an honorific title and the feminine form of address for the honour of damehood in many Christian chivalric orders, as well as the British honours system and those of several other Commonwealth realms, such as Australia and New Zealand, with the masculine form of address being Sir. The Most Honourable Order of the Bath is a British order of chivalry founded by King George I on 18 May 1725. Knights in the Middle Ages were mounted soldiers who held land in exchange for military service. Knight bachelor, most ancient, albeit lower ranking, form of English knighthood, with its origin dating to the reign of Henry III in the 13th century. The feudalization of England that followed the Norman Conquest of 1066 integrated the knights, then around 5,000 in number, into the new system. Knights Code of Chivalry *Vows of Knighthood. Medieval Knighthood was one of the most central themes prevalent during medieval times in Europe. The life of a medieval knight was governed by a certain set of rules which was known as the Code of Chivalry.. According to this code, medieval knighthood expected the …Knight. A knight in the Middle Ages was a warrior horseman. A knight was called Sir, and was usually of a noble or a genteel family. Knighthood, however, was not inherited; it had to be earned by many years of training. Besides a sword and a shield, a knight in combat might carry a battle-ax, mace or lance.
